**Prefer the allowlist over re-baselining for per-finding decisions.** The allowlist carries a typed category + reason + (when relevant) expiry; the baseline carries only "this finding was here." Future maintainers reading `vyuh-dxkit allowlist show <fingerprint>` see WHY the suppression is in place; reading the baseline file shows only that the finding existed at capture time. Per-finding decisions belong in the allowlist; codebase-wide brownfield acceptance belongs in the baseline.
|
|
242
278
|
|
|
243
279
|
**Never** re-baseline a finding silently — the commit message should explain why the regression is accepted. Future maintainers reading `git log .dxkit/baselines/` should see the rationale.
|
|
244
280
|
|
|
281
|
+
**Refresh the baseline in CI, not locally.** When a re-baseline is the right call, run it through the bundled `dxkit-baseline-refresh` workflow (or a runner pinned to CI's scanner versions) — not a local `npx vyuh-dxkit baseline create --force`. A local refresh records your machine's semgrep / npm-audit / jscpd versions in the committed baseline; when they differ from CI's, the next PR's guardrail surfaces spurious `TOOLING-DRIFT` warnings and phantom "resolved" findings. A local `--force` is fine only for the very first capture or a throwaway experiment.
